George Ware (R) - N.C. State Senate District 32

Q: How important is it for the NC General Assembly to ensure citizens have access to healthy and affordable food?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: When elected, how will you help combat food insecurity in Forsyth County and North Carolina? (open-ended question)
A: Propose NC increase funding to inner city and county non profit groups that support and operate food dispensaries.

Q: How important is it for the NC General Assembly to take action against climate change? (1-5 scale) 
A: 3

Q: How will you address climate change when elected?  (open-ended question)
A: Encourage NC to work towards developing high tech burn centers with newer technology that will safely allow burning of plastics without harmful fluorocarbons into the air.

Q: How important is it for Forsyth County and North Carolina to shift to renewable energy sources such as solar, wind, and hydropower?  (1-5 scale) 
A:  3

Q: When elected, how will you increase the use of renewable energy in Forsyth County and across the state of North Carolina? (open- ended question)
A: Encourage NC to invest in affordable funding for home solar panels with created electricity being sold back to Duke Energy

Q: How important is equitable, accessible public transportation?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: How important is it to design streets for people to walk, bike, bus, and drive safely?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: As a representative in the state assembly, how will you advocate for equitable public transit and more multi-use streets?  (open-ended question)
A: Invest heavily in new public walkways and bike paths along existing city and county roads

Q: How important is it for representatives for the NC General Assembly to protect the quality and availability of water sources?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: In what ways will the NC General Assembly protect water sources and make sure safe water is available to all communities? (open-ended question)
A: Increase clean water resources and significantly increase fines for the abuse of our waterways.

Q: How important is it for the NC General Assembly to pass policies that combat environmental racism?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: As a representative for Forsyth County, how will you address issues of environmental justice? (open-ended question)
A: Demand that NC drastically increase inner city funding programs that support food banks, day care for working mothers and fathers and to see that needed support for community policing and recruitment are available.

Q: How important is it that the NC General Assembly propose policy ensuring just and equitable development?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: How important is it that NC General Assembly propose policy ensuring sustainable, affordable housing? (1-5 scale) 
A: 5

Q: As a representative for Forsyth County, what policy would you propose to safeguard just and equitable development practices in our community? (open-ended question)
A: Increase funding for inner city youth programs so children can be children and enforce longer jail sentencing for crimes against children.
